Output 6d0128ef3abc526e5e94b7fa7f100652fe815cfd607eeb3bcc3cfcacbba343af:52

value
63735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f97e95a1108b671c14ca2930eb3ea4d9b5b9f4 OP_EQUAL
address
39M2tePQ9ihRHtE53VHF9jagKHbqext79T
transaction
6d0128ef3abc526e5e94b7fa7f100652fe815cfd607eeb3bcc3cfcacbba343af
confirmations
279365
spent
true